Which companies in Pennsylvania sponsor visas for finance analysts?
Large financial institutions and multinational corporations are the most consistent sponsors. In Pennsylvania, that includes Vanguard, PNC Bank, Lincoln Financial Group, Comcast, and AmerisourceBergen. These employers have established HR and legal infrastructure to support H-1B visa and other work visa filings. Smaller regional firms sponsor less frequently, so targeting large-cap employers or companies with a documented history of LCA filings gives candidates the best starting point.
What visa types are most common for finance analyst roles in Pennsylvania?
The H-1B is the most common visa category for finance analysts in Pennsylvania, as the role typically q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ring at least a b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, economics, or a related field. Candidates already holding L-1 visa transfers, O-1 visas, or OPT/STEM OPT work authorization also appear regularly in this space. Some multinational employers use L-1 visa transfers for analysts moving from a foreign affiliate.

Which cities in Pennsylvania have the most finance analyst visa sponsorship jobs?
Philadelphia is the primary hub, driven by its concentration of asset managers, insurance companies, banks, and corporate finance teams. Vanguard's headquarters in Malvern (Greater Philadelphia) alone generates significant analyst hiring. Pittsburgh is a secondary market with growing activity from PNC Bank, BNY Mellon's operations, and a developing fintech sector. Harrisburg and Allentown have smaller but present finance employer bases, primarily in insurance and regional banking.
Are there any Pennsylvania-specific factors finance analysts should know when pursuing visa sponsorship?
Pennsylvania's finance sector is anchored by asset management and insurance, which creates stable, long-cycle hiring rather than boom-and-bust tech-style waves. The state hosts several large universities including Wharton, Carnegie Mellon's Tepper School, and Penn State that feed domestic talent pipelines, but those same institutions also produce international graduates who frequently pursue sponsorship locally. Employers filing LCAs in Pennsylvania must meet Department of Labor prevailing wage requirements for the specific region and job classification.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ored finance analyst jobs in Pennsylvania?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
